What companies run services between Hilton The Hague, Netherlands and Rotterdam, Netherlands?

You can take a vehicle from Hilton The Hague to Rotterdam Central Station via 's-Gravenhage, Mauritskade, Den Haag, Centraal Station Uitstaphalte, and The Hague in around 1h 2m. Alternatively, RET operates a subway from 's-Gravenhage, Den Haag Centraal to Rotterdam, Stadhuis every 15 minutes. Tickets cost €4–6 and the journey takes 33 min.
